Cheapest Available Forest Hills Apartments for Rent and Nearby

 

The cheapest available apartment rental in Forest Hills, PA is a 1 Bed unit found at Della Plaza in the East Allegheny neighborhood priced from $710. The Flats on Penn in the East Hills neighborhood has the second lowest priced unit, which is a Studio apartment currently listed from $730. Here is today’s list of the most affordable Forest Hills apartments for rent:

Apartment ListingModel NameBed/BathPriced From
Della PlazaOne Bedroom1BR,1BA$710
The Flats on PennRadcliffStudio,1BA$730
2206 Woodstock Ave1 Beds, 1 Baths1BR,1BA$850
Edgewood Court Apartments1x11BR,1BA$925
William Penn HeightsKALLA/ANICO1BR,1BA$950
Brittany ApartmentsStudioStudio,1BA$994

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Forest Hills Apartments

What is the Cheapest Studio apartment in Forest Hills?

Currently the most affordable Cheap Studio Apartment in Forest Hills is at The Flats on Penn listed at $730.

How much is rent for a Cheap One Bedroom Forest Hills Apartment?

The lowest price for a Cheap One Bedroom Forest Hills Apartment is $710 at Della Plaza.

What is the lowest price for a Cheap Two Bedroom Forest Hills Apartment for rent?

Today's best deal for a Cheap Two Bedroom Apartment in Forest Hills is starting from $1,100 at Carriage House Apartments.

What is the most affordable Forest Hills Three Bedroom Apartment?

The best deal on a cheap Forest Hills Three Bedroom Apartment rental is at 9608 Frankstown Rd and starts from $1,495.
